Impacts of ENSO on wintertime PM2.5 pollution over China during 2014-2021
文献摘要:
2013年以来中国实施了一系列减排政策,大气污染物浓度明显下降,但由于气象条件的年际变化,中国PM2.5(空气动力学直径小于2.5 μm的颗粒物)污染仍然存在.厄尔尼诺-南方涛动(ENSO)是调节大气-海洋系统年际变化的最强信号.本文研究了2014-2021年四次ENSO事件期间,中国四个特大城市群冬季PM2.5浓度的变化.结果表明,在京津冀和汾渭平原地区,由于厄尔尼诺(拉尼娜)期间的偏南风(偏北风)异常有利于PM2.5 的积累(扩散),冬季PM2.5浓度在厄尔尼诺年高于拉尼娜年.在珠三角地区,由于厄尔尼诺冬季水汽通量和降水的增加有利于大气中PM2.5的湿清除,冬季PM2.5浓度在厄尔尼诺年低于拉尼娜年.在环流和降水异常的综合作用下,ENSO对长三角地区PM2.5浓度的影响难以预测,应逐案分析.
